Introduction

Often serving as outside general counsel, Elaine represents privately held and family-owned companies in transactional matters including M&A, joint ventures, and equity and debt financings.

Elaine Kwak specializes in partnership and LLC matters, drafting and negotiating complex operating and partnership agreements for investors and companies. More broadly, she advises private companies on corporate governance, organizational structure, and strategic planning. This includes guiding companies through corporate restructurings, from strategic rationale through execution and downstream impact. 

While her practice spans multiple industries, Elaine has worked extensively in consumer products, food and beverage, and agriculture, counseling clients on commercial contracts throughout the supply chain, including product development, supply, manufacturing, co-pack, private label, warehousing, marketing, and distribution. 

Elaine maintains an active pro bono practice, advising nonprofit organizations on tax-exempt status, entity formation, and general corporate matters.
